Senior Software Engineer

A company focused on innovation and technology acceleration, creating mobile-first solutions and products.
Frontend
Senior Software Engineer
Remote
6+ years of experience
AI · Enterprise SaaS

Description For Senior Software Engineer

Robots & Pencils is a pioneering company that believes in the transformative power of mobile technology and innovation. Founded in 2009 with the vision that mobile would be more impactful than the Internet, they've proven to be ahead of the curve. The company follows a talent-led culture, attracting highly skilled professionals who develop innovative solutions and create previously inconceivable products.

As a Senior Software Engineer at Robots & Pencils, you'll be part of a dynamic team working on client products and in-house projects. Your responsibilities will include building mobile APIs and web applications, peer reviewing code, supporting sales and project managers with technical insights, and applying your expertise to resolve challenges innovatively.

The ideal candidate will have 6+ years of relevant experience, strong knowledge of JavaScript, HTML, and CSS, and experience with Angular and API integrations. You should be comfortable with precompilers, responsive design, and test-driven development. The role requires a demonstrated ability to learn new technologies and a strong understanding of user interface guidelines for web and mobile.

Robots & Pencils offers an attractive compensation package, excellent benefits, and a flexible work environment. You can work remotely from anywhere in North America or choose to work in one of their local offices. The company values work-life balance and fosters a culture of continuous learning and innovation.

Join Robots & Pencils to be part of a team that's shaping the future of technology and creating solutions that transform businesses. If you're passionate about pushing the boundaries of what's possible in software development and want to work with top-tier talent, this could be the perfect opportunity for you.

Last updated 2 months ago

Responsibilities For Senior Software Engineer

  • Work on Client products and in-house products, delivering first-class software
  • Build out mobile APIs and web applications for mobile and browser Clients
  • Peer review other team members' code, and learn and adapt from peer review of your own code
  • Support sales and project managers with technical insights, leading to the creation of budgets and schedules for projects
  • Apply wisdom and knowledge to resolve issues and challenges while looking for new innovative solutions

Requirements For Senior Software Engineer

JavaScript
  • 6+ years of relevant professional experience
  • Degree in Computer Science/Engineering or completion of a Tech Bootcamp (preferred)
  • Robust knowledge of native JavaScript, HTML, and CSS
  • Experience with preprocessors like SASS or LESS
  • Comfortable using precompilers (e.g. - Webpack, Babel)
  • Experience working with Angular
  • Proficient in working with API's and third party integrations
  • Demonstrated ability to learn new technologies
  • Strong understanding of responsive design and development
  • Experience with test-driven development and basic understanding of QA Processes
  • Understanding of common user interface guidelines and standards applied to web and mobile
  • Knowledge of project management techniques
  • Advanced knowledge of SEO and web analytics practices and platforms

Benefits For Senior Software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
Equity
  • Attractive compensation package
  • Medical, Dental, Vision insurance
  • Paid holidays, vacation, and sick days
  • Flexible paid holidays
  • R&P branded swag
  • Parental & adoption leave top up / salary continuance
  • 401K/RRSP matching
  • Remote work options
  • Fast-paced environment
  • High-quality talent team
  • Continuous learning opportunities
  • Team-building events and activities

Interested in this job?

Jobs Related To Robots & Pencils Senior Software Engineer

Senior Software Developer - Oracle Analytics Cloud (OAC)

Senior Software Developer position at Oracle Analytics Cloud, focusing on frontend development for enterprise analytics platform with 4+ years experience required.

Senior React Developer

Senior React Developer position focused on building high-quality web applications using React.js, leading team initiatives, and implementing best practices.

Sr. Frontend Engineer

Senior Frontend Engineer position at BlueCat, developing enterprise network solutions using Angular and Node.js in a hybrid work environment.

Crypto Senior Full Stack Developer

Senior Full-Stack Developer position at Token Metrics, focusing on cryptocurrency investment platforms using AI and blockchain technology.

Mid/Sr Frontend Developer/Fullstack Developer (Exchange)

Senior Frontend Developer role at Crypto.com to develop and maintain cutting-edge cryptocurrency trading platform UI, requiring 5+ years experience with JavaScript and React.